KMS at a Glance
Mission Statement: We aim to help our students to become healthy, self-confident, aware individuals who are excited by learning and have a great thirst for knowledge by introducing dynamic learning experiences according to Montessori principles. The Result: The Children become life long scholars and responsible citizens of their community. Emphasis: Small classes with low student-teacher ratios, inspired Montessori-trained teachers, and classrooms designed with the child in mind, make KMS a true 'Children's House'. Additionally: We offer a weekly music program, as well as after-school Spanish lessons. In the interest of comparison: The TCAP standardized achievement test is given annually to all elementary students. Facility: Housed in a lovely turn of the century Tudor-style home KMS has a large protected and well-equipped outdoor area enables children to play and work on large motor skill development. Students also help to cultivate gardens adjacent to the playground. Availability KMS has flexible hours depending on the age and needs of the child. A full-time or a part-time program is available for Primary pre-school children. Minimum enrollment is correlated to the age of the child.
